NOAA is reporting that Tahoe City, CA just had its wettest October in over 100 years of recording keeping.

Tahoe City saw 437% of normal precipitation in October 2016!  

Tahoe City saw 9.04″ of precipitation in October 2016.

“October 2016 was very wet in many areas of the Sierra and western Nevada. At Tahoe City, 2016 was the wettest October in over 100 years of precipitation records with 437% of normal precipitation.” – NOAA, today

Unfortunately, the next two weeks in Lake Tahoe are looking pretty dry…
